Obaidul: Jamaat to face strong resistance during hartal if needed


Awami League General Secretary Obaidul Quader has said that Jamaat will face strong resistance if it creates panic among the public through subversive activities during its hartal on Thursday. Obaidul, also the road transport minister, made the comment while visiting the Metro Rail Depot at Diabari in Dhaka on Wednesday morning. On Tuesday evening, Bangladesh Jamaat-e-Islami called a dawn-to-dusk countrywide shutdown protesting the arrest and remand of its top nine leaders including the ameer, the nayeb-e-ameer and the secretary general. On Monday evening, detectives arrested Jamaat Ameer Maqbul Ahmad, Nayeb-e-ameer Mia Ghulam Parwar, Secretary General Dr Shafiqur Rahman and Chittagong Metropolitan Ameer Mawlana Shahjahan among others from a house in Dhaka’s Uttara area. A Dhaka court on Tuesday afternoon put the nine to remand for a total of 10 days, for two cases previously filed under the Special Act and Explosives Act.
